Kaarel Kuddu is a Product director at Wise. Kaarel has a long history in IT with over 10 years of experience and has participated in some of the biggest IT projects in Estonia. He spent 6 years at Wise Grew from Product Lead there to VP of Product. He then quit to start his own company, a mental health app which he then decided to close down after a year, because it was not having a significant enough impact on its users mental health. As Kaarel told - it is not so easy to make an impact on that via app, and we discuss that more on the episode.
